yt-dlp can download in audio formats (and also download whole playlists at once)
Not without Deno anymore, google just took a great big shit on it :(
2025.09.26 can still do it without deno. Besides, when the change happens, node and bun (never heard about bun before) will be supported as well, not just deno, but they will require extra arguments passed to yt-dlp. If using yt-dlp directly, and already having node or bun installed, no need for deno then.
